Boat Driver Killed; Race Continues
- Share via
A driver in the Parker, Ariz., Enduro Classic was thrown from his power boat and killed during Sunday’s three-hour marathon on the Colorado River near this border community opposite California.
Witnesses said Dave Griffith, a deputy sheriff from Hawthorne, Nev., was thrown over the left forward portion of the boat when it hooked in the north turn of a two-mile loop. Griffith lost his crash helmet as he hit the water and was sent cartwheeling, witnesses said.
A caution flag was displayed as emergency teams removed his body from the water, but the race continued.
The race lasted seven hours last year, but was shortened because of insurance problems.
